Major Uses of Portable Buildings

Portable buildings which are also known as modular buildings have become very popular due to their many uses. Traditionally, these were thought as temporary structures on demand. These were seen as situational units which could be used for several weeks, months or years depending on the circumstances on the ground. This perception has changed and many people are embracing the concept due to their very many uses. These are ideal for individuals, households, institutions as well as organizations and businesses.

Just like the traditional buildings, portable buildings serve the same purposed at a lower cost both in construction and maintenance. Once you establish your housing needs, the fabricating specialists will be able to run you through the available units for you to choose ones that suit your needs. This way, you can units which are for institutional use like classrooms and lecture halls and these can customized to fit in to the existing buildings both in structural construction and décor as well.

Modern real estate specialists are tuning to portable buildings for home and property owners who want to go green. There are many organizations and individuals who are searching for such structures either for their families, businesses, resource centers or leisure. These green buildings popular due to their resource efficiency and the quality is controlled contrary to the convectional property construction.

Many constructors and manufacturers of portable buildings have over the years improved the quality to make them durable and long term utility structures. Some of these structures are favorites for day care centers, churches, office space, campaign offices and health care facilities. These come with unique features which suit your needs. Eco tourism enthusiasts are also turning to these portable units to minimize negative effects on the environment too.

Many companies go for portable buildings before they construct other permanent structures. Once these permanent units are completed, the portable ones are turned to resource centers, storage units or places for staff to relax and unwind during breaks. These are hardly pulled down as they for part of the company's history on the particular site.

There are companies that prefer portable buildings due to the nature of their work. Road construction and mining companies prefer these units because they keep relocating to different locations when they get new contracts or prospecting. Alternatively, they prefer these because they take a maximum of 90 days to get a portable unit onsite thus saving them waiting time and money.
